Are you a candidate?
Before you even think about the volume of fat that can be removed, the first step is to determine your candidacy for this treatment. Dr. Cusimano recommends that good candidates for a lipo are individuals who are in good overall health, wish to address localized areas of stubborn fat that aren’t responding to diet and exercise, and have realistic expectations about the outcomes of this procedure.
What are the limitations?
Liposuction is a safe and proven procedure. However, there are limits to the amount of fat that Dr. Cusimano can extract during your lipo in Baton Rouge LA. Plastic surgeons are very keen to follow these guidelines in order to ensure the patient’s safety as well as minimize any potential risks associated with excessive removal of fat during a single session.
How much fat can you remove?
The collective volume of fat that is removed during your liposuction plastic surgery will vary based on factors such as your overall health, your body mass index (BMI), and the specific treatment areas being targeted. Generally, Dr. Cusimano aims to remove anywhere between 2 and 5 liters (4.4 – 11 lbs) of fat.

How to select a good plastic surgeon for liposuction?
Selecting a highly qualified plastic surgeon is one of the most important considerations for patients who are looking to undergo a lipo. Below are some steps that you can follow to make sure that you make the right decision:
- Start by researching the surgeon’s credentials, qualifications, and board certifications.
- Read patient reviews and testimonials to assess the surgeon’s track record and patient satisfaction.
- Schedule a consultation to personally assess the plastic surgeon’s communication style and approach to patient care.
- Ask relevant questions during the consultation so you can address any concerns or doubts.
- Select a surgeon who is willing and able to listen to your goals, as well as display empathy and provide realistic expectations.
- Assess to see if you have confidence and comfort in the surgeon so you ensure your comfort throughout the liposuction experience.
